TICKET-4471: Flaky integration tests in Pennygate payments service

The `settlement_retry` suite fails ~30% of runs on the Ombra CI pool. Root cause looks like the mock ledger container starting before its seed data loads. Blocked: the fixtures live in the Pennygate test vault, which auto-locked after three bad attempts last Thursday. Nobody on rotation can open it. To unblock before Friday's sync, unlock the vault with the recovery passphrase below.

strongbox words: zorwyn-sorael-belion-ulaius-silmir-ulays-briax-rusdor-gorix

The secrets vault for MeasureWise, the recipe-scaling calculator, locked itself after three failed login attempts by the overnight support shift. Until it's reopened, the unit-conversion service can't fetch its signing key, so scaled recipes render without verified badges. Customer impact is cosmetic but visible. Per the escalation guide, any support lead can unlock the vault from the admin console once identity is confirmed with the on-call manager. The passphrase required at the unlock prompt is:

recovery phrase for fajeg-hagug: holox-fenmir

Handover — Vexler partner SFTP drop

Ownership moves to you today. Drop runs hourly from Vexler's end into the intake bucket via the relay host. Watch for zero-byte files; their exporter flakes on Mondays. Creds live in the ops vault, path noted in the runbook. Vault auto-seals after 48h idle. Support escalations go to the on-call rotation, not me. If the vault is sealed when you need it, unseal with the recovery passphrase below.

recovery phrase for tadug-fafof: zorwyn-kasion

Handover: Brackenport health checks. The Fernway LB now probes /healthz every 5s; anything over 2 failures drops the node. Deep checks (DB ping) moved to /readyz — don't conflate them in review. Timeout is 800ms, intentional. Watch for the flapping fix in the retry branch. Questions about probe config go to the owner below.

account owner for bawip-tahag: Raleth Quenok